Our client, a leading Canadian wealth management organization is looking for an Associate Equity Capital Markets to join them on a 12 month contract. The role will be working hybrid at their offices in downtown Toronto.

Manage non-brokered private placements, including subscription review, submission, communication, ticketing, and settlement Support brokered financings by coordinating with dealers, tracking orders, and helping complete transactions Work with internal teams to ensure compliance with firm policies and regulatory requirements Maintain accurate transaction records, documentation, and pipeline tracking Perform daily inventory management and reconciliations in Dataphile and NIAD Assist with transaction execution and other team priorities as needed Requirements
